# Java 保留5小数 在进行科学计算或者涉及到精度要求较高的计算时,我们常常需要保留小数点后几位。在Java中,有多种方法可以实现保留小数点后5的功能。本文将介绍其中的几种方法,并提供相应的代码示例。 ## 方法1:使用DecimalFormat类 `DecimalFormat`类是Java中用于格式化数字的类,可以实现数字的格式化和解析。通过`DecimalFormat`类,可以设
原创 2023-10-28 04:15:25
307阅读
java保留小数问题:方式一:四舍五入  double   f   =   111231.5585;  BigDecimal   b   =   new   BigDecimal(f);  dou
转载 11月前
37阅读
## Java保留小数的方法 在Java中,保留小数是一个常见的需求。有时候我们需要对小数进行精确计算,有时候则需要将小数保留指定的位数。今天我们来讨论如何在Java保留小数,并且让我们的小数保留5。 ### 保留小数的方法 Java中有多种方法可以帮助我们保留小数,最常见的是使用DecimalFormat类。这个类可以帮助我们将小数格式化为指定的样式。 下面我们来看一个简单的示例
原创 2024-05-02 06:00:59
59阅读
# 保留5小数JAVA应用 ## 引言 在实际项目开发中,经常会遇到需要保留小数位数的需求。而在JAVA中,保留小数位数可以通过格式化输出实现。本文将介绍如何在JAVA保留5小数,以及如何解决一个实际问题。 ## 问题描述 假设我们正在开发一个交易系统,该系统需要计算不同商品的折扣价格和税后价格。我们知道,价格通常是小数,而且需要保留一定的位数以确保计算的准确性和精度。因此,我们需要在
原创 2023-09-07 08:34:26
235阅读
如下是一个用于实现“java math保留5小数”的步骤表格: | 步骤 | 描述 | | --- | --- | | 步骤1 | 导入`java.math`库 | | 步骤2 | 创建一个`BigDecimal`对象,并将需要保留5小数的数值传递给它 | | 步骤3 | 在`BigDecimal`对象上调用`setScale`方法,指定保留小数的位数为5 | | 步骤4 | 使用`ROUN
原创 2023-12-17 08:19:36
58阅读
import java.math.BigDecimal; import java.text.DecimalFormat; import java.text.NumberFormat; public class format { double f = 111231.5585; public void m1() { BigDecimal bg = new BigDeci
转载 2023-05-22 11:04:47
192阅读
# 如何在Python中保留5小数 ## 简介 作为一名经验丰富的开发者,我将向你展示如何在Python中保留5小数。这对于许多数据处理和计算任务是非常重要的。在下面的文章中,我将逐步指导你完成这个过程。 ## 流程图 ```mermaid graph TD A(开始)-->B(输入一个数字) B-->C(保留5小数) C-->D(输出结果) D-->E(结束) ``` ## 步骤及代
原创 2024-02-29 03:23:10
313阅读
double x = 123456789.987654312; String.format("%.nf", x)n为保留小数位,x必须为double类型。 例如保留3小数String.format("%.3f", x);输出为123456789.987; 
转载 2023-06-19 15:26:47
283阅读
## 如何在Java中实现double相除并保留5小数 ### 1. 流程图 ```mermaid erDiagram Developer -->> Beginner: 教学 ``` ### 2. 实现步骤 以下是在Java中实现double相除并保留5小数的具体步骤: | 步骤 | 描述 | | --- | --- | | 1 | 创建两个double类型的变量,分别用来存
原创 2024-03-03 03:55:39
78阅读
## 如何实现Java金额转换并保留5小数 ### 概述 在Java中,金额转换并保留5小数是一个常见的需求,特别是在金融领域。本文将介绍如何实现这一功能,适合于刚入行的小白开发人员。 ### 流程图 ```mermaid erDiagram 实现金额转换并保留5小数 { 操作员 --> 步骤1: 获取金额 步骤1 --> 步骤2: 转换金额格式
原创 2024-04-08 05:59:29
26阅读
## Java中float保留5小数Java中,浮点数是一种用于表示实数的数据类型,可以包括小数部分。然而,由于浮点数的存储方式和精度限制,导致在进行浮点数运算时可能会出现精度丢失的问题。为了解决这个问题,我们经常需要对浮点数进行舍入或保留特定位数的小数。 本文将介绍如何在Java保留5小数,并提供相应的代码示例。 ### 使用DecimalFormat类进行保留小数 Java
原创 2023-07-31 14:04:29
450阅读
INSTR(str,substr)返回子串substr在字符串str中的第一个出现的位置。这与有2个参数形式的L
原创 2022-11-28 17:47:19
398阅读
保留小数位的方法:使用BigDecimal.setScale()方法格式化小数点float result = 12.565; BigDecimal bd = new BigDecimal((float)result).setScale(2,BigDecimal.ROUND_HALF_UP);setScale(args1,args2)args1:要保留小数的位数,例子中为保留2小数args2:保留
转载 2023-05-23 15:45:15
306阅读
# Java设置Double类型保留5小数Java中,double类型是一种用于表示浮点数的数据类型。它可以用来存储较大或较小的十进制数,并具有比整数类型更高的精度。然而,由于浮点数的特性,double类型的值可能会存在一定的误差。如果我们想要在计算中保留特定位数的小数,就需要对double类型的值进行舍入或格式化操作。 本文将向大家介绍如何使用Java设置double类型的值保留5
原创 2023-10-22 16:46:31
252阅读
在 Python 中可以使用 NumPy 库来对数组进行修改。可以使用 NumPy 的 round() 函数将数组中的每个元素都四舍五入到五小数。例如:import numpy as np # 假设有一个浮点数组 a a = np.array([1.23456, 2.34567, 3.45678]) # 使用 round() 函数将数组中的每个元素都四舍五入到五小数 b = np.roun
转载 2023-06-06 22:53:37
231阅读
java保留几位小数的方法:import java.text.DecimalFormat;double a=1.23456,result;DecimalFormat df =new DecimalFormat("#.0…")(几个0就是几位小数)result=df.format(a);也可以直接用格式符输出:System.out.printf("%n.f",a);//保留n小数输出
转载 2023-05-23 14:31:59
184阅读
# Java实现保留小数 ## 简介 在Java开发中,我们经常需要对数字进行格式化处理,其中一种常见的需求就是保留指定位数的小数。本文将介绍如何使用Java实现保留小数的功能。 ## 实现步骤 下面是实现保留小数的步骤,可以通过表格展示: | 步骤 | 描述
原创 2023-09-19 04:09:24
138阅读
# Java小数保留4 在进行Java编程时,经常会遇到需要保留小数点后4的情况。本文将介绍如何在Java中实现小数保留4的方法,并提供相应的代码示例。 ## 1. DecimalFormat类 Java中提供了DecimalFormat类,它是java.text包下的一个工具类,用于格式化数字。我们可以使用DecimalFormat类来实现小数保留4的需求。 **代码示例1:**
原创 2024-01-06 12:40:03
360阅读
## Java 保留4小数 ### 1. 引言 在Java编程中,我们经常需要对浮点数进行精确控制。有时候,我们需要将浮点数保留到固定的小数位数,比如保留4小数。本文将介绍如何在Java中实现这一目标,并提供相应的代码示例。 ### 2. Java中的浮点数 在Java中,有两个基本的浮点数类型:`float`和`double`。其中,`float`类型用于表示单精度浮点数,占用4字节
原创 2023-08-23 08:32:20
1712阅读
# Java保留小数Java中,我们经常需要对浮点数进行精确的计算和表示。保留小数位数是一种常见的需求,特别是在涉及货币、科学计算和统计分析等领域。本文将介绍如何在Java保留小数,并提供代码示例。 ## 什么是保留小数 保留小数意味着我们希望以五小数的精度来表示一个浮点数。例如,将一个浮点数保留小数后,它的小数部分将包含五数字。 ## Java中的浮点数表示
原创 2023-09-08 08:18:00
249阅读
  • 1
  • 2
  • 3
  • 4
  • 5